Commemorative issue

Coronation of Princess Louise of Britain as Queen of Denmark

Obverse

Mantled bust of Queen Louise facing right

Script: Latin

Lettering:
LOVISA • D • G • DAN • NORV • VAND • GOTH • REGINA •
• ARBIEN • F •

Translation: Louise Dei Gratia Queen of Denmark, Norway, the Wends and the Goths

Engraver: Magnus Gustav Arbien

Reverse

Two angels holding a crown over the radiant mirror monogram of Queen Louise. Below the earth's hemisphere in clouds with the outline of Denmark and Norway

Script: Latin

Lettering:
ET GENERI DEBITA ET VIRTVTI.
_______________
MDCCXLVII.
D. IV. SEPT

Engraver: Magnus Gustav Arbien
